How do I Update the drivers on my laptop?

Update the device driver

  1. In the search box on the taskbar, enter device manager, then select Device Manager.
  2. Select a category to see names of devices, then right-click (or press and hold) the one you’d like to update.
  3. Select Search automatically for updated driver software.
  4. Select Update Driver.

How do I Update my firmware on my Acer laptop?

How to Update BIOS Acer

  1. Check the PC model (like Swift SF314-52) and BIOS version.
  2. Go to Acer website and choose Support > Drivers and Manuals.
  3. Choose PC Category, Series, and Model.
  4. Expand BIOS/Firmware.
  5. Download the latest BIOS version.
  6. Extract the BIOS folder.

How do I update my Acer monitor driver?

Go to the driver download website of Acer,then search your product.

  • Download the correct and latest driver for your monitor to your computer. Download the driver that’s suitable for your variant of Windows system.
  • Open the downloaded file and follow the on-screen instructions to install it on your computer.
